
Growing lemons at home turns out to be a fairly simple task if you plant the seeds correctly and do not forget to care for the plant. In this article, we will talk about the nuances of growing one of the most useful and aromatic citrus fruits.
The next time you enjoy a lemon, don’t rush to throw away the seeds – they could be the beginning of your own lemon tree. Even during the winter months, the lemon tree can thrive with you, giving you a pleasant aroma and freshness. The lemon, with its evergreen leaves and large white flowers, not only adorns the interior, but also provides you with healthy fruit all year round.
PREPARATION BEFORE PLANTING
Pick the seeds from the lemon and choose 12-15 large and healthy ones, without visible damage. Peel them from the flesh and soak them in warm water overnight to speed up germination.
